aboutsummaryrefslogtreecommitdiff
path: root/weed/mq/broker/brokder_grpc_pub.go
diff options
context:
space:
mode:
Diffstat (limited to 'weed/mq/broker/brokder_grpc_pub.go')
-rw-r--r--weed/mq/broker/brokder_grpc_pub.go16
1 files changed, 16 insertions, 0 deletions
diff --git a/weed/mq/broker/brokder_grpc_pub.go b/weed/mq/broker/brokder_grpc_pub.go
new file mode 100644
index 000000000..a26be5171
--- /dev/null
+++ b/weed/mq/broker/brokder_grpc_pub.go
@@ -0,0 +1,16 @@
+package broker
+
+import (
+ "github.com/seaweedfs/seaweedfs/weed/pb/mq_pb"
+)
+
+/*
+The messages is buffered in memory, and saved to filer under
+ /topics/<topic>/<date>/<hour>/<segment>/*.msg
+ /topics/<topic>/<date>/<hour>/segment
+ /topics/<topic>/info/segment_<id>.meta
+*/
+
+func (broker *MessageQueueBroker) Publish(stream mq_pb.SeaweedMessaging_PublishServer) error {
+ return nil
+}